Federal Reserve Independence Debate Reaches a Critical Juncture

Presidential pressure on the Federal Reserve has reignited a decades-old debate about central bank independence from political influence.

Administration officials have made repeated public statements calling for interest rate reductions from the Federal Reserve, departing from the convention that the White House does not publicly pressure the independent central bank on monetary policy decisions. The Fed chair has publicly reaffirmed the institution's independence while declining to engage directly with the political pressure in remarks that have been carefully parsed by markets.

Economic historians note that central bank independence is ultimately a legal and political construct rather than an absolute safeguard. The relevant statutes give the president significant influence over the Fed's composition through appointments but do not provide authority to direct monetary policy decisions. However, sustained political pressure combined with the eventual replacement of multiple board members through the normal appointment process could gradually shift the institution's policy inclinations.
